Statute of limitations
A statute of limitations is a legal rule which sets the deadline for when you are able to file suit for an injury. It is often compared with a clock that begins at a certain time, is delayed or paused until it expires. The statute of limitations runs out when you cannot make a claim. The court will dismiss the case if the statute of limitations has expired. The law is designed to deter individuals from bringing unwarranted lawsuits and to protect the at-fault party from being sued later for negligence.
Each state has its own statute of limitations rules and there are a variety of nuances that can differ from case to case. In New York City you have three years to file a lawsuit for personal injury or product liability. However, certain types of cases have a different statute of limitations, for instance medical malpractice lawsuits which have a shorter period of time. In certain situations the deadline for statutory claims can be extended or "tolled".
For instance, if someone is injured as a result of negligence by a health care provider, the clock on the statute of limitations doesn't begin until you are aware of your injuries, or the doctor should have reasonably discovered them. This is called the discovery rule and is a common exception to the statute of limitations. Another exception occurs when the injured person is a minor, and in some instances, the statute of limitations might not begin running until they reach a specific age.
The most important thing to bear in mind is that when the statute of limitations runs out at the end of the year, you will not be allowed to file a claim for your injury. This is why it is essential to consult an injury attorney immediately after the incident to determine how long you have left. It is best to make a claim immediately following the incident. In some cases when you are waiting too long, the evidence for your case may become outdated and difficult to prove. Additionally the at-fault party as well as their insurance company will be less likely to take your claim seriously if it is filed too late.

Case Preparation
Preparing a trial case takes time and money. It requires collecting medical documents, invoices for auto repair police reports and photos and other evidence to back up your claim. The process can be stressful and a good injury lawyers Near me injury attorney will prepare you for what to expect from the other side of the table. Your lawyer might also ask you to be an open book. This isn't easy for clients who are sensitive to privacy.
It is expensive and time-consuming to build a strong case for full compensation. Your lawyer will have to employ experts in fields that are outside the normal scope of their practice, for instance, doctors who can explain why your injury could require further surgery or an economist who can prove how much your injury has impacted your life and ability to earn. These experts are costly and are likely to be required to testify at court.
Your lawyer will draft an official demand letter that tells your story through describing your injuries and presenting the evidence of how your injuries have affected your life. This will include an amount of money to cover all of your medical expenses, lost wages, and any future loss of earning capacity. This will cover your suffering, pain and any other economic and non-economic expenses.
It is important to remember that you are subject to intense scrutiny by the lawyers of the other side and investigators. Your behavior should be professional and respectful. In court, any unprofessional comments or actions will be considered against you. It is important to follow the advice of your doctors and legal team.
